## Turnstile Counter — Account Recovery

If the Gatewick counter service locks out the release account mid-deploy, do not reset via console. Stop ingest, confirm stadium feed at Harrowfen is paused, then invoke the recovery flow from the ops box. When prompted, enter the passphrase that follows.

unlock words, kagef-taduf: fenir-quenix-norwyn-sorvan-gormir-gorir-fraok

Welcome to on-call for Verdantix, our greenhouse controller fleet. Humidity sensors in the Larkmoor bays drift upward roughly 2% per week; the nightly calibration job normally corrects this. If drift exceeds 8%, vents may open unnecessarily and you'll get paged. Run the recalibrate script from the jump host, then confirm readings settle within ten minutes. The jump host prompts for the controller recovery passphrase, which is listed directly below.

vault phrase of bagaf-kajeg = jorath-feniel-briir-siliel-ralix

**Mgmt Meeting Minutes — Retiring the Brightline Range**

Quick recap for sales leads at Fenholt Supplies: we agreed to retire the Brightline fixture range by year-end. Remaining stock moves to clearance pricing next month, and accounts on standing orders get migrated to the Lumetta range. Trade-in incentives were approved in principle. The confidential note on next steps sits just below.

board note of bajof-bajeg: The pricing group signed off on a budget of $13.4 million for Project Sildor. The renewal with Lamixek Holdings closes at $48.9 million a year, 49 percent above the last contract.